Why Buy Power Tools Online?
Conventional brick-and-mortar hardware stores have high overhead expenses, which are typically passed down to the customer in the form of higher prices. Online merchants, on the other hand, use several distinct advantages:
- Price Transparency: Consumers can easily compare prices throughout multiple websites within seconds.
- Vast Selection: Online platforms provide access to specific niche brand names, international manufacturers, and hard-to-find specialized tools that regional stores may not equip.
- Access to Reviews: Buyers can read hundreds of genuine customer evaluations and enjoy video demonstrations before purchasing.
- Exclusive Online Deals: Many manufacturers and merchants offer web-only discount rates, clearance occasions, and bundled promos.

New vs. Reconditioned vs. Used: Which Should You Buy?
When searching for cheap power tools online, comprehending the condition categories can save buyers cash while mitigating risk.
| Tool Condition | Pros | Cons | Best Power Tools Deals For |
|---|---|---|---|
| Brand New | Full maker guarantee, zero wear and tear, peak efficiency. | Highest price point among budget alternatives. | Sturdy expert usage, safety-critical applications. |
| Factory Reconditioned | Checked, fixed, and certified by the maker; significantly less expensive. | Much shorter guarantee duration (normally 90 days to 1 year). | Budget-conscious DIYers desiring trusted brand-name equipment. |
| Used/ Second-Hand | Rock-bottom rates, typically includes accessories or storage cases. | No service warranty, unidentified history of usage, prospective concealed damage. | Experienced tinkerers, really light or infrequent usage. |
Top Tips for Scoring the Best Online Deals
Finding the least expensive cost isn't simply about clicking "include to cart." Smart online buyers utilize particular techniques to optimize their savings.
- Use Price Tracking Tools: Browser extensions like Honey or CamelCamelCamel permit buyers to track cost history on Amazon and other websites, ensuring the "sale" price is genuinely a bargain.
- Look for Tool-Only Bundles: If a collection of cordless tool batteries is currently owned, acquiring "tool-only" (bare tool) versions without batteries and chargers can slash expenses by 40% to 50%.
- Check for Manufacturer Rebates: Many tool brands run seasonal mail-in or online refunds, offering money back or free batteries with select online purchases.
- Sign Up for Newsletters: Subscribing to favorite tool outlet newsletters often yields a 10% to 15% discount code on the very first order.
Mistakes to Avoid When Buying Cheap Tools Online
While saving cash is amazing, ultra-cheap tools can often provide security hazards or break down prematurely. Keep these cautions in mind:
- Beware of "No-Name" Brands: If an online listing includes an unpronounceable trademark name with hundreds of five-star reviews composed in broken English, continue with care. These are often low-quality dropshipped items.
- Consider Shipping Costs: A tool that looks incredibly low-cost may have exorbitant shipping costs connected at checkout. Constantly look for free shipping thresholds.
- Inspect the Return Policy: Buying online means not being able to hold the tool initially. Ensure the seller has a problem-free return policy in case the tool feels poorly well balanced or stops working upon arrival.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
Are low-cost online power tools safe to use?
It depends upon the brand name and the source. Low-cost tools from trustworthy budget brands (like Ryobi, SKIL, or Porter-Cable) or reconditioned name-brand tools are generally really safe. However, unbranded, ultra-cheap imports might lack appropriate security accreditations (such as UL or ETL listings), positioning electrical or mechanical threats.
What is a factory-certified reconditioned tool?
A reconditioned tool is a product that was returned to the producer, often due to a minor defect, cosmetic imperfection, or simply due to the fact that a consumer changed their mind. The manufacturer examines, repairs, tests, and repackages the tool to ensure it meets original factory standards, usually selling it at a significant discount rate.
Is it better to buy corded or cordless tools on a budget plan?
For budget buyers, corded tools are often more affordable and offer more continuous Power Tool Suppliers UK than entry-level cordless tools. Cordless tools require financial investment in batteries, which can increase the expense. However, if flexibility and movement are needed, look for entry-level 18V or 20V cordless environments where one battery fits multiple tools.
How can I spot fake power tools online?
Counterfeits are most common on third-party marketplaces like eBay or Amazon marketplace. To avoid them, purchase directly from licensed merchants, look for main holographic seals on packaging, and watch out for costs that appear "too good to be true" for high-end brands like Makita, DeWalt, or Milwaukee.
